    The original library of the University of Houston was established in 1927 when the school was known as Houston Junior College. [1] With 1,988 volumes, the library was housed as a section of the San Jacinto High School library, where the college shared building space. Ruth Wikoff was the school's first professional librarian.

    The University of Houston System Board of Regents voted to establish a medical school at the system's flagship campus in 2017. [1] The Texas Legislature authorized the medical school in 2019. [2] The UH College of Medicine enrolled its inaugural class of 30 students in 2020. All students in the inaugural class received full tuition scholarships ...

    The University of Houston–Clear Lake ( UHCL) is a public university in Pasadena and Houston, Texas, [4] with branch campuses in Pearland and Texas Medical Center. It is part of the University of Houston System. Founded in 1971, UHCL had an enrollment of more than 9,000 students for fall 2019. [5]
